In this episode of the a16z Podcast, Anish Acharya and Steven Sinofsky discuss Andre Karpathy's talk on the changing landscape of software development due to AI, comparing the current AI platform cycle to the early days of personal computing. They explore the concepts of "vibe coding" versus "vibe writing," the implications of partial autonomy and jagged intelligence in AI tools, and the challenges of automating tasks that require human judgment, using examples from financial services and medicine. The conversation touches on the role of product managers in addressing ambiguity and the potential for AI-generated content, while also examining Google's recent I/O event and its broader platform strategy, emphasizing the importance of adapting product-building approaches in the face of technological disruption.
